  • SOL001/SOL004 Standard Conformance

    • VNF Package

      • A VNF Package is a compressed file that contains the following:
        • One VNF descriptor (VNFD)
        • One or more Software Image files
        • Zero or more manifest files
        • Other files
      • Package structure is SOL004 2.5.1 compliant.

      • Note: SDC in Dublin has limitations and restrictions on SOL004 support:
        • SDC does not allow custom directories such as Images, Scripts, Licenses and HOT in the root directory.
        • SDC requires MainServiceTemplate.mf and MainServiceTemplate.yaml in the root directory
        • As a result, in Dublin, the vendor VNF package should follow SDC onboarding rules. These SDC restrictions and limitations plan to be removed in the El Alto release. 
    • Cloud Service Archive (CSAR) format

      • It is a packaging construct defined in SOL004 2.5.1, identified by a .csar suffix on the package file. In SOL004, there are two package options; one with TOSCA-Metadata, one without TOSCA-Metadata directories: 

        • The CSAR file does not contain TOSCA-Metadata directory, the descriptor yaml file is in the root directory of the CSAR.

        • The CSAR file contains TOSCA-Metadata directory, the TOSCA meta file in this directory contains the location and name of the descriptor file denoted by Entry-Definitions

      • In ONAP, the second option (with TOSCA-Metadata) is supported.
      • Note: in SDC El Alto, if the VNF package with certificate and/or signature will be packaged as a zip file. The csar format continues to be used for the package without certificate and/or signature. The zip file without certificate and/or signature will be considered as an HEAT-based package.
    • VNFD

      • It is specified by the SOL001 2.5.1.

      • Note 1: that the input and get_input function would be used by a TOSCA orchestrator at run time to access the selected input parameter. If the deployment is not done by a TOSCA orchestrator, the inputs and get_input function may not be needed. The VNFD design should follow the vendor SVNFM orchestration capabilities. 
      • Note 2: in Dublin, SDC will convert SOL001 VNFD to SDC AID DM, but it is not complete. More mapping design discussions are necessary in El Alto.

    • SO VNFM Adapter component is a sub component of SO; utilizing docker image and container managed.
      • North Bound Interface (NBI)
        • RESTful APIs that support createVnf (invokes both createVnf and instantiateVnf), grantVnf, TerminateVnf/DeleteVnf
        • Its APIs are SO specific; i.e., not SOL003-based ones; for the NB API details, see the SO VNFM Adapter APIs page.
      • Business Logic layer
        • It is invoked by the NBI and provides business logic for createVnf, instantiateVnf, terminateVnf/DeleteVnf
        • SDNC and A&AI access to collect assignment and VimConnectionInfo
        • Accesses SdcPackageProvider for getting SOL004 package(s) and parameters
        • SdcPackageProvider
          • Supports SOL001/SOL004 package management
          • Provides getPackage, getVnfdId, getFlavorId, getVnfNodeProperty
          • Provides getPackage(s), getVnfd, getArtifactFile for SVNFM
          • Uses SDC Tosca Parser
        • GrantManager
          • Provides requestGrantForInstantiate REST API for SVNFM
          • Invokes OOF for homing decision; HPA support, and/or non-OOF decision
        • SOL003Lcn APIs
          • Supports VnfIdentifierCreationNotification, VnfIdentifierDeletionNotification, VnfLcmOperationOccurrenceNotification
      • SOL003 Communication Layer
        • It is a thin REST client layer, which sends SOL003-compliant requests to SVNFMs and receives responses/notifications from SVNFM.
        • For Grant, it provides the Grant REST endpoint for SVNFM
        • For the SOL003 Southbound API details, see the  SO VNFM Adapter APIs page.

    1. SO BPMN Service workflows dispatch new resource-level workflows based on VNF request parameters (e.g., type, others).
      1. Once a Service workflow chooses a new workflow path for VNFM Adapter, the subsequent requests for the same VNF will follow the new path.
      2. an association between VNF and VNFM will be made in A&AI.
    2. SO BPMN VNF-level resource workflows handle:
      1. Assign VNF to SDNC
      2. Retrieve the VNF Assignment from SDNC
      3. Invoke VNFM Adapter Client with required parameters
    3. VNFM Adapter Client manages:
      1. Populate parameter structures based on data from SO workflows
      2. Invoke VNFM Adapter NBI with required parameters
    4. VNFM Adapter gets GenericVNF from A&AI
    5. VNFM Adapter locates the corresponding VNF and VNFM registration info form A&AI (ESR). Two methods are suggested
      1. Current one: based on VNF NF Type and VNFM Type in A&AI
      2. Could use VNFD vnfm_info:type, VNFM registration values: VNFM type, Cloud Region, vendor - logic is being designed
    6. VNFM Adapter gets VimConnectionInfo from A&AI
      1. Queries A&AI based on the cloud region and tenant id
      2. Builds the VimConnectionInfo based on the type, service-url, user-name, password, cloud-domain, etc.
    7. VNFM Adapter uses network assignment (e.g., IP Address) from SO (thru SDNC) and builds the extVirtualLinks and other parameters.
